WebMar 18, 2024 · Open the workbook and select the worksheet for which you want to print the gridlines. Click the “Page Layout” tab. NOTE: This option is specific to each worksheet in your workbook. In the “Sheet Options” section, select the “Print” check box under “Gridlines” so there is a check mark in the box. WebClick "Print Titles" in the Page Layout's Page Setup group or click the small arrow at the bottom right of the Page Layout's Sheet Options group. Check "Row and Column Headers" and then click "OK" to add row numbers and column letters to each page of the printout for selected sheets.

WebDec 27, 2024 · This first option is the quickest method to print a selected range of cells. Select and highlight the range of cells you want to print. Next, click File > Print or press Ctrl+P to view the print settings. Click the list arrow for the print area settings and then select the “Print Selection” option. WebIf you now want to print your sheet, press CTRL+P (if you’re on a Mac, press Cmd+P), or navigate to File->Print. This will bring you to Print Preview mode. From here, you can see on the right-hand side how your print page is going to look. If everything looks alright, press the large Print button on the left-hand side to start printing.
